Development of a Framework for Stakeholder Engagement with Success Metrics for Hubs for Circularity

Research output: Contribution to conferenceAbstractAcademic

Abstract

The paper introduces a framework for assessing stakeholder engagement and success in Hubs for Circularity (H4C), essential in transitioning to a Circular Economy (CE). It stresses the necessity of collaboration among stakeholders and the need for a structured approach to evaluate the efficacy of H4C endeavours. This framework comprises several key elements: Firstly, it emphasizes the importance of analysing the diverse stakeholder groups involved in H4C initiatives. Secondly, it advocates for a comprehensive examination of the factors influencing the implementation of H4C through a Drivers, Barriers, and Enablers Analysis (DBE). Thirdly, it underscores the development of metrics aligned with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) and Societal Readiness Level (SoReL) to measure the success of H4C initiatives. Lastly, it outlines future research directions, highlighting the potential use of social network analysis (SNA) and regional input-output (RIO) modelling to explore the socio-economic impacts of H4C initiatives. In essence, the paper highlights the significance of stakeholder engagement and measurement frameworks in driving the success of H4C initiatives and advancing sustainability goals.
